Output 173e33fa88b51ea809c1ecbf04c3a357fb1343b64e2fe5694864e07340fa3982:1

value
8484862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2ae8084cd3c9d710918ea72dc0706c5b5abbd27 OP_EQUALVERIFY OP_CHECKSIG
address
1JkP8q3vJwA9kTLyzupMT47msnXHR9cK4R
transaction
173e33fa88b51ea809c1ecbf04c3a357fb1343b64e2fe5694864e07340fa3982
spent
true